Prior Experience
Prior to joining Stembridge Taylor, Isabel worked at Buckley Bala Wilson Mew, where she managed the firm’s intake team for several years and later served as a litigation paralegal. Her work experience prior to entering the legal field is diverse and extensive. Isabel worked closely with the owners of Saturn Supplements, Inc. to facilitate the operation and worldwide growth of the international health/fitness company. Prior to that, she was Co-founder of Omada Technology Solutions, a boutique healthcare IT consulting firm. And for eight years before founding Omada, Isabel served as Director of Marketing for APCO Graphics, Inc., an award-winning leader in the architectural signage industry. Isabel is a magna cum laude graduate of Georgia State University, and she also earned a paralegal certificate from Emory University.
